FA: SCM: OM: Submitting an Order Fails With: JBO-29000: JBO-29000: Unexpected exception caught: oracle.apps.scm.pricing.priceExecution.algorithms.publicQuery.exception.SetQueryException, msg=An error occurred while sorting two incomparable values. java.la (Doc ID 2657281.1)

Last updated on JULY 14, 2020

Applies to:

Oracle Fusion Order Management Cloud Service - Version 11.13.20.01.0 and later
Information in this document applies to any platform.

Symptoms

A Draft order is imported into system from an external order capture application, an error is reported when users submit the order:

NOTE: The Item is tax exempt.

JBO-29000: Unexpected exception caught: oracle.apps.scm.pricing.priceExecution.algorithms.publicQuery.exception.SetQueryException, msg=An error occurred while sorting two incomparable values. java.lang.Integer cannot be cast to java.lang.Long

Additional errors are reported in the SOA Trace which can be accessed by support engineers:

<PriceRequestInternal:PricingMessage>
     <PriceRequestInternal:HeaderId>300000154848115</PriceRequestInternal:HeaderId>
     <PriceRequestInternal:MessageName>QP_PDP_CALC_TAX</PriceRequestInternal:MessageName>
     <PriceRequestInternal:MessageText>An error occurred while calculating tax. A tax exempt transaction line is entered without entering the tax exempt reason. Enter a tax exempt reason for this transaction line.</PriceRequestInternal:MessageText>
     <PriceRequestInternal:MessageTypeCode>ERROR</PriceRequestInternal:MessageTypeCode>
     <PriceRequestInternal:ParentEntityCode>LINE</PriceRequestInternal:ParentEntityCode>
     <PriceRequestInternal:ParentEntityId>300000154848111</PriceRequestInternal:ParentEntityId>
     <PriceRequestInternal:PricingMessageId>300000154139317</PriceRequestInternal:PricingMessageId>
  </PriceRequestInternal:PricingMessage>
